“Sexism impacts every aspect of black women’s lives, including how we’re treated, or not addressed, in media after our deaths. Yet our experiences with law enforcement are very similar to that of black men.” ~ Evette Dione, Bustle.com

Meagan Hockaday, Tanisha Anderson, Yvette Smith, Miriam Carey, Shelly Frey, Darnisha Harris, Malissa Williams, Alesia Thomas, Shantel Davis, Rekia Boyd, Shereese Francis, Aiyana Stanley-Jones, Tarika Wilson, Kathryn Johnston, Alberta Spruill, Kendra James. This is just a partial list of Black women who have been murdered by police officers. Meagan was shot to death March 28 by an Oxnard, California cop in front of her children. https://www.facebook.com/meaganmatters?fref=ts Misha Charlton, Meagan’s sister, has been working tirelessly to raise awareness about her sister’s murder; no national mainstream media outlets have reported on this story.
